logo

Output ec50512308b8a891b498bd84d059b76d7c0a020661e2d0d01aa4ecd7c99ee665:1

value
39050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f9d489003c74a1b86d8c36a5e6d95255163d527 OP_EQUALVERIFY OP_CHECKSIG
address
15LmBGAqqnfy2isoj4r6tX5rVF7sBdi4sC
transaction
ec50512308b8a891b498bd84d059b76d7c0a020661e2d0d01aa4ecd7c99ee665